#a57291 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a57291 is composed of 64.7% red, 44.7%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.9% magenta, 12.1%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 323.5 degrees, a saturation of 22.1% and a lightness of 54.7%. #a57291 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4ff with #4b0023.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

● #a57291 color description : Mostly desaturated dark pink.
#a57291 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a57291 has RGB values of R:165, G:114,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.12,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10842769.
